Golden Lady
Fragrance notes
Character
Golden Lady opens with bitter orange and bay leaf. The citrus is sharp and the leaf adds a green, aromatic edge. Orchid sits in the top layer and brings a pale floral touch that softens the opening without turning it sweet.
The heart introduces Damask rose and neroli. The rose is prominent and powdery, while the neroli adds a fresh, white floral tone. Together they create a floral core that feels dry rather than lush, with a faint camphor accent running through it.
Sandalwood anchors the base. It is smooth and woody, giving the floral and citrus notes a calm foundation. The wood does not dominate, but it keeps the composition steady and prevents the rose from feeling too airy.
The ingredient list is short, which keeps the scent clear but also limits its depth. Once the rose and sandalwood settle, there is little left to discover, and the narrow range of notes makes it feel simple compared to more layered floral fragrances.
